Poke root, Avoid and Don’t touch this Beauty
It’s so stunning I had to share this majestic plant. I found it growing in ditches bordering a National trust property. As a Herbalist, we use the root (Phytolacca decandra) to great effect in the clinic for lymphatic congestion. But it mustn’t generally be handled, touched etc. Ariel parts can cause vomiting, nausea, low blood pressure etc.
Used properly its invaluable for mumps, glandular fever and indeed for chronic rheumatism.
